Summary

  • Dr. Sean Kumer is a Transplant and HPB surgeon in Kansas City and is affiliated with multiple hospitals in the area, including The University of Kansas Health System and Children's Mercy Hospital Kansas City. He received his medical degree from The University of Vermont and has been in practice for 14 years. He specializes in hepatobiliary surgery and transplantation and is experienced in transplant surgery, pancreatic surgery, general/gastrointestinal surgery, hepatopancreatobiliary surgery, and hepatic and biliary surgery.
